Andrew Pulliam is a member of the Firm's Litigation & Dispute Resolution Service Team. He concentrates his practice in the areas of civil and commercial litigation.

Professional Experience
- Officer in the United States Navy, 1984-1989. Qualified as Nuclear Engineer by Office of Naval Reactors. Served on U.S.S. Nimitz and U.S.S. Arkansas.
- Area Manager at DuPont's New Johnsonville, Tennessee, titanium dioxide plant from 1989-1991.
Education
1994 - J.D., with honors, Vanderbilt University; Order of the Coif, member of the Vanderbilt Law Review, 1992-1994 and was Senior Managing Editor, 1993-1994
1984 - B.S., with honors, United States Naval Academy at Annapolis, Maryland
